  • Valid period for stored documents (Archive Link)

    Hello,
    Can someone please confirm if the stored documents within Archive Link can be retrieved after more than 10 years or is there an expire date setting?
    Thanks.

    SAP does not work like "Mission Impossible", that a document disappears itself after a certain time.
    If you archive documents, then it is still up to you, when you want to dispose this archive.
    E.g. you have to keep financial data for 10 years as requested by law.
    But you want keep your database small and want have a good performance.
    So you decide to archive everything what is older than e.g. 2 years.
    The older documents are written to an archive file and deleted from the table spaces.
    The archive can stay in the SAP file system (quickest access) or in an external archive system like IXOS.
    You have to make sure that you keep this archive with data older than 2 years for another 8 year to comply with the legal requirement.
    If the 10 years have past, then you archive the archive information (this has the info where your archive is located)  itself  and remove the indexes to the archived documents that are older than 10 years.
    Then you take the disk from the IXOS system and destroy it.
    If you dont archive the archive infos (SARA for BC_ARCHIVE) and dont destroy the archive files then you may be able to access the data far beyond the 10 years.

  • How do you access iCloud (non-Pages) stored documents on iCloud

    How does one access iCloud (non-Pages) stored documents on iCloud? Only iWork shows up.

    iCloud does not provide general file storage: only iWork docucuments (at the moment) will upload to iCloud for access by other devices/computers. There aren't any other documents stored up there.

  • SapWorkDir - Stored document - 21 files download limitation

    Hi
    Sap Gui Version: 620 sp44
    Scenario: User opens stored document(Tif file stored in content server) attached to a Sap Document ID.  The Stored Document(Tif file) is downloaded to the PC SapWorkDir directory.
    Technical Limitation: I think there is a limitation of 21 Tif files that SapGui can store in the SapWorkDir.  On the 22nd tif file download the SapGui starts to overwrite the first tif file hence it goes through a 21 file cycle.  Naming convention is retained eg APRD01, APRD02… APRD21.
    Problem: If a user tries to open a previously accessed Sap Document ID Stored Document(Tif file) the SapGui does not download the tif to the SapWorkDir directory.  Instead it looks like it checks a SapGui cache and opens the Tif file it originally downloaded to SapWorkDir directory.  This Tif has obviously been overwritten because of the limitation of the 21 file download cycle.
